I was using Azure to host all my files that is needed for DesignExplorer.

Microsoft provide a free 1 G storage web host on Azure, and here is the link:https://azure.microsoft.com/en-us/pricing/details/app-service/

Microsoft will give you a customized domain, such as http://yoursite.azurewebsites.net, and then after you uploaded all images, you can access files by http://yoursite.azurewebsites.net/yourfolder/image.jpg, and you can use this link for DesignExplorer.

I've been working with DesignExplorer and encountering some of the same issues I've seen other people are struggling with. Here's what I found:

1. Files had to have at least 61 runs - no idea why but otherwise I'd get the img and threeD text strings coming in as inputs/outputs (see below)

2. I could use dropbox but I had to repalce https://dropbox.com/ with https://dl.dropboxusercontent.com/ and delete the "?dl=0" from the end of the link . Supposedly this creates a "directly downloadable file". It's also the format from the DE sample file. 

3. The ftp hosting (from Tasos) worked for my images but not for my json files. 

I'd be curious to see if anyone else has struggled loading json files that are hosted on an ftp site. I'd prefer the ftp method to dropbox because copying dropbox links is tedious.
